An exciting opportunity has arisen to work within a well-established community pulmonary rehabilitation team here in Shropshire, Telford and Wrekin, supporting patients to make positive life choices that enhance their lives and health. We are looking for an administrator to join our team. As part of the Pulmonary Rehabilitation team you will be expected to work independently in liaison with the Clinical Lead, physiotherapists, nurses and rehabilitation technicians to assist them in delivering care to patients in our community. You will work alongside and build relationships with the Community Respiratory Nursing teams, local GP surgeries, secondary care Respiratory colleagues and other community teams. The successful applicant will demonstrate excellent communication and organisational skills and an ability to work flexibly within the team.,

  • Assisting the Pulmonary Rehabilitation service with caseload administration
  • To undertake routine clerical, IT and word processing, data inputting, filing, photocopying and general office duties
  • Telephone duties, ensuring that all calls are received in an efficient and helpful maner with messages recorded accurately and actioned in a timely manner
  • Ordering of stores, stamps and equipment and maintaining relevant records
  • Dealing with routine correspondance and enquiries on own initiative
  • To ensure the timely distribution of mail, email and correspondance within the team.
  • Organise any sessions / appointments for clinicians
  • Follow up on non-attendees and defaulters of their scheduled appointments as requested by the healthcare professional
  • Set up Pulmonary Rehabilitation clinics and programmes for clinicians
  • Minute taking for team meetings

    Shropshire Community Health NHS Trust provides community-based health services for adults and children in Shropshire, Telford and Wrekin, and some services in surrounding areas too. These range from district nursing, health visiting and running four community hospitals through to providing very specialist community care through talented and dedicated staff.
